dogs do not leave "presents" by peeing on your things.
when a dog pees on something, it is either they have to pee (usually just on the ground, from what I have seen and experienced -having dogs all my life, and breeding, handling and training) or if they are peeing on specific areas and things, it is a sign of dominance and leadership, and could be considered disrespectful if it is someone else's territory.
this is why dogs pee over each other's scents in parks, or at home, and cover a human's scent they deem to be dominant over...

Its also called "marking"...their territory both males and females do this.
Like saying "this is mine...whizzz...this is mine too...whizzz
neutering a male sometimes helps this behavor or making them wear a belt made for male dogs to prevent this
